Father Peter M. Denges, pastor of Holy Redeemer Catholic Church, Kill Devil Hills, and his brother, Monsignor Joseph F. Denges, pastor of St. Stephen's Church, Washington, D. C., will accompany Francis Cardinal Spellman, Archbishop of New York, on the largest 1958 Lourdes Centennial Pilgrimage Cruise, sailing from New York September 8 on the T. S. S. Olympia, Flagship of the Greek Line, one of the most modern and luxurious ships in the cruising field today.
It is estimated that more than ten million pilgrims from all corners of the world will visit the sacred Shrine of Our Lady of Lourdes in the remote picturesque foothills of the majestic Pyrenees Mountains, which form a wall on France's southern frontier.
A stream of water and eighteen apparitions seen only by an uneducated, simple young peasant girl these have been the outward signs of the Great Miracle of the 19th century, which has brought the entire Catholic world on its knees in pilgrimage to Lourdes, the most famous pilgrimage shrine in the world.
While in Rome, Father Peter and Father Joseph Denges will visit their brother, Father Benedict Denges, who is celebrating this year his 30th Anniversary in the holy Priesthood.
